We are seeking a dynamic and experienced HR Manager to oversee HR functions across our four care Homes covering over 230 employees located across South East England. This is a fantastic opportunity for a skilled HR professional who is passionate about supporting people, enhancing workplace culture,

What You'll Do to give you an idea:



Oversee HR operations and ensure compliance with employment law and company policies. Partner with managers managing complex Employee relations cases including disciplinary, grievance, attendance and performance management. Partner with Managers to ensure Monitoring, tracking of contracted hours, sickness patterns, and annual leave. Lead staff file audits and ensure consistent HR standards. Overseeing employee engagement initiatives and internal communications. Produce quarterly workforce reports and support annual pay review processes. Drive engagement initiatives including staff surveys. Use your experience to enhance/streamline the HR systems and processes

What We're Looking For:



Proven HR management experience (health or care sector preferred). CIPD Level 5 or above. Strong understanding of UK employment law and HR best practices( this role will be supported by Avensure specialists in Employment Law). Excellent organisational and interpersonal skills. Able to manage sensitive situations with discretion and professionalism. Confident working independently. Proficient in Microsoft Office (especially Word and Excel). Ability to manage multiple priorities across different sites. The Role will be primarily working from home and visits to the care homes as and when required, for this a driving licence is required.
